Received DS-3032 / I-864 Bill : Is this the AOS bill on the payment portal or the kit that i need to receive from NVC?? I'm confused... Received AOS bill yestareday. --> Yes, it is the AOS Bill.

Pay I-864 Bill 2010-11-10

Receive I-864 Package : What does this mean? Will i receive smth in the mail or email?? --> you will receive an email with instructions to complete the I-864 packet. You don't have to wait for any email. Just mail you AOS packet after the system shows paid and printing the bar coded coversheet.

Does anyone know the AVR messages according to steps?

1) NVC Assigns a Case#: This case was entered in the NVC computer system on ____________. The case number assigned by the NVC is (Case #). Please allow 6-8 week from this date for the beneficiary to receive the documents

2) DS3032/ AOS Fee Bill Generated: NVC will mail...the beneficiary..." OR "DS3032 and AOS Fee Bill has been generated on____________."

3) DS3032 Entered in the System: NVC has received the DS3032, Choice of Agent and Address form on____________. Please allow 4-6 weeks before you will be notified by NVC.

4) AOS Fee Processed: NVC has received the DS3032, Choice of Agent and Address form on____________, and will send further instructions within the next few weeks..

5) IV Fee Bill Generation: The Immigration Visa Fee Bill letter has been generated on____________, and will be sent within the next few weeks..

6) IV Fee Bill Processed: NVC has received IV fee bill on ____________. and will send further instructions within next few weeks.

7) DS-230 Generation: NVC is expecting return of the biographic forms by the petitioner..

8) DS-230 Receipt: The NVC has received the checklist letter response on ____________..." OR "The NVC received your documents on ____________. Please allow 6-8 weeks from this date for the NVC to review your documentation and notify you of the outcome of the review."

9)Case Complete: your Case was completed on____________. Please allow 8 weeks for further instructions...

10) Case Forwarded to Embassy: The NVC has completed the case and forwarded it to the Embassy or Consulate in.

Does this sequences sound right?
